10772630
0x31e96b18cca144b915faa600c7bd26e5ec739bad85242c90841491aa4d059d2f
Transactions0
Height10772630
Confirmations5796669
Timestamp491 days 10 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x6828196ef3623cc6
Bits
Difficulty0x213c4bef